Web1 dec. 2001 · Zheng He’s Junks. Zheng He’s flag “treasure ship” was four hundred feet long – much larger than Columbus’s. In this drawing, the two flagships are superimposed to give a clear idea of the relative size of these two ships. Columbus’s ship St. Maria was only 85 feet long whilst Zheng He’s flag ship was an astonishing 400 feet. WebDuring the second expedition between 1407-1409, “the fleet went to Zhaowa ( Java), Guli (Calicut, Kezhi (Cochin) and Xianle ( Siam). The kings of these countries all sent as tribute precious objects, precious birds and rare animals” (Zheng He, Pg, 3). Additionally, in 1409 the fleet began revisiting countries that had traveled to before. His … easy anti cheat fehler 32Web25 feb. 2024 · Zheng He was a Chinese explorer who lead seven great voyages on behalf of the Chinese emperor. These voyages traveled through the South China Sea, Indian Ocean, Arabian Sea, Red Sea, and along the east coast of Africa.
